Subject: DR Drill Results — ParityPulse Rate Checker

As part of our quarterly disaster-recovery drill, we restored the ParityPulse rate-parity checker from cold backups in the Veldrun secondary region. Restore completed in 41 minutes, within our RTO target. All scraping schedules resumed correctly after we re-seeded the comparison queue. One caveat: the restore requires the offline recovery passphrase to unseal the credentials store, so I'm recording it here for your review.

vault phrase of taweg-kafof = oliax-zorael

The FeeForge rules engine, which computes shipping fees for Marlowe Mercantile checkouts, is intermittently failing to reach its rules database since the 14:20 deploy. Symptoms: pool acquisition timeouts every few minutes, fee evaluation falling back to cached rules. Restarting the service clears it for roughly an hour. Suspect a leaked connection in the new tier-lookup path. On-call: please enable pool tracing and capture a leak report. Use the staging database via the connection string below.

replica DSN, kagaf-kajef: postgresql://eliius_svc:UA@db-a408.paliqnet.internal:5432/istys

**Vendor note: Inkmill markdown pipeline**

Rendering for Parchway docs is outsourced to Inkmill under an annual contract, renewing each March. They handle sanitization and PDF export; we own the upload queue. SLA: 4-hour response on rendering failures. Escalate only after two failed retries. Their support desk is reachable at the address below.

billing contact of hahaf-baguf = zorael.tammir.jorius@sivrelhq.internal

FACILITIES TICKET — Vantrell House

Request: Room 3C configured as secure interview room, effective tonight. Blinds down, recording light checked, spare chairs removed. Night shift: keep the door locked between sessions and log each entry. Cleaning is suspended in 3C until further notice. Use the temporary door code below to open the room.

turnstile pass: bdg-NG-3

Handover: health checks behind the Kestrel load balancer. Probes hit /healthz every 10s; two failures drain the node. Support note: "degraded" in Vistaboard usually means the cache warmup check, not an outage. Don't restart nodes manually — the drainer handles it. Runbook is in the Ops wiki. On-call owner going forward is named below.

account owner for tawef-yadug: Jorius Normir Silath